“Without a doubt, the highest expression of the harp maker’s art,” reads a description of the 1916 Lyon & Healy harp that inspired today’s glorious Louis XV Special concert grand harp. Inspired by the rococo style seen in French King Louis XV’s time, the harp conveys a light yet elaborate style of art, incorporating leaves, flowers, scrolled feet and shapes reminiscent of shells.
The Louis XV Special has elaborate carving along its neck and kneeblock, as well as intricate carving along the soundboard edges, both on the sides and surface. Clad in lavish 23+ karat gold leaf, the Louis XV also features an exquisite hand-painted floral trellis design on its soundboard.

Louis XV Special
Technical details

Dimensions
Height: 74 3/4" 190 cm
Width: 41 1/2" 105 cm

Weight
89 lbs
40 kg

Soundboard width
21 5/8"
55 cm

Range
47 strings
0 Oct. G - 7th Oct. C

Soundboard
Pacific Northwest Sitka Spruce

Finishes
23+ Karat Gold; Natural or Bubinga
